Answer:
The two numbers following 1,-2,3,-4,5... are -6 and 7.
Step-by-step explanation:
index: 1 2 3 4 5 ....
value: 1 -2 3 -4 5
Let the index be n. Then the first term is a(1), the secon is a(2), and so on.
a(2) = 2*(-1)^(2-1) = 2*(-1) = -2 (correct)
a(3) = 3*(-1)^(3-1) = 3*(-1)^2 = 3 (correct)
a(4) = 4*(-1)^(4-1) = 4*(-1)^3 = -4 (correct)
So the general formula for a(n) is: a(n)=n(-1)^(n-1)
Thus,
a(5) = 5(-1)^4 = 5
a(6) = 6(-1)^5 = -6
a(7) = 7(-1)^6 = 7
The "next two numbers in the pattern" are -6 and 7. The first 7 numbers are
1,-2,3,-4,5, -6, 7

Answer:
m<4 = 34°
Step-by-step explanation:
m<2 = 34° (given)
m<3 + m<2 = 180° (linear pair)
m<3 + 34° = 180° (substitution)
Subtract 34° from each side
m<3 = 180° - 34°
m<3 = 146°
m<4 + m<3 = 180° (linear pair)
m<4 + 146° = 180° (substitution)
Subtract 146° from each side
m<4 = 180° - 146°
m<4 = 34°
This shows that vertical angles are congruent.
m<2 and m<4 are vertical angles formed when two straight line intersects. They are both of equal measure.
